The total amount was $120.

A portion of the $120 was for parts.

The rest of the $120 was for service. Service cost $12 per hour.

Start with $120.

Subtract $72 to find the amount spent on service.

$120 - $72 = $48

$48 was spent on service.

The service costs $12 per hour.

$48/($12/hour) = 4 hours

Answer: 4 hours

Check:

$72 in parts + 4 hours * $12/hour = $72 + $48 = $120

4 hours is correct.
